The creation of Donkey Kong Bananza started with destruction.

"What we were really going for was this gameplay experience that comes from destruction," Bananza director Kazuya Takahashi says in an interview with The Verge. From that simple premise, Bananza's creators have built an entire game about breaking stuff.

Bananza is the second major Switch 2 exclusive from Nintendo, and it's made by the same developers that worked on Super Mario Odyssey, one of the games that came out during the launch window of the original Switch.
